Virtual-Hideout reviews Mushkin’s XP2-8500 modules (1066MHz). The motherboard they used wasn’t able to supply more than 2.4 volts to DDR, so they only managed to push it to 1100MHz @ 5-5-4-12 before seeing instability, but they obviously hadn’t hit the memory’s top speed.
